Our family of 5 stayed here over April School Vacation. Pros: This resort is centrally located and walking distance to Thames Street where all the shops and restaurants are located so you do need to drive everywhere. We loved to location and the staff was excellent. We used RCI Timeshare Exchange to stay here for a week. The front desk staff was very helpful in checking in. We had requested a room with an water view and view. They gave us the choice of 3 rooms to look at and choose which one we wanted. The ladies at the front desk also know the area very well. Everything from restaurants to sites to see was at our finger tips from talking to them. The heated indoor/outdoor pool along with 2 hot tubs(1 indoor/1 outdoor) was a huge hit. The large sitting area with the wide screen TV’s was great for the my wife and I to sit and relax while the kids were in the pool. They have a exercise room with plenty of equipment/weights, an onsite movie theater which was nice and we were able to watch Divergent. The game room is small but includes an air hockey table, pool table and a few arcade games. Our room was big, we had a 2 bedroom with a full kitchen and washer and dryer. Be sure to ask for a room with the washer/dryer, some do not have one. Con: The internet signal was OK but we didn’t mind because it gave us time to actually do things with the kids without being time sucked with IPads, Ipods, etc… but the signal can be touch and go at times. Best Places to eat: Brick Alley Pub, Diegos, Lucia’s, Via Via for Pizza Best things to do: The Mansions, Cliff Walk, Castle Hill Light House, Goat Island Lighthouse, Brenton Point/Ocean Drive, Thames Street One interesting tidbit: right across the street from the Wyndham Long Wharf is where the fishing docks are located. There is a Lobster/Crab shack right there where you can get lobsters/crabs right off the boat at cheaper prices, bring them back and cook them yourselves. We loved it here and the kids already want to go back

My parents were given some days here in April as a retirement gift and my sister, my kids and I spent a few of the days there with them. We enjoyed our time there and my almost five year old LOVED the indoor/outdoor pool. We were there for less than 72 hours and used the pool six times! It was very warm. Be aware that you must sign the towels out under your room number. I have mainly stayed in hotels in past experience and was not used to this. Other places I’ve stayed just kept towels out and about for anyone to use, so people were a bit protective of there towels here which was unusual for me. The rooms were clean and comfortable. A few things I didn’t like, we had two cars but you are only allowed one parking space so my sister needed to park her car on the road, which was thankfully free the time of year we were there. However, there were clearly plenty of parking spaces in the resort, so it just seemed unnecessary that they wouldn’t allow her to park in the resort given that the parking lot was never even close to full. Also they apparently have a theatre and show movies three times a day, but for a family with young children the movie times were quite inconvenient falling over nap time, dinner time and after bed time, so we were unable to use this feature, but for families with older kids, the times may be less inconvenient. Overall, it was a pleasant stay.

We stayed thru a timeshare and enjoyed our time. My 10 year old LOVED the indoor/outdoor pool, especially since it was cold & rainy. No really! Since it is obviously heated, we had a blast! We also took advantage of using the cute little movie theater and popcorn. We brought sodas and a blanket from our room and it was even cozier. Staff was lovely. Rooms were decent. Biggest complaint is that the walls are not sound insulated ATALL. And since they use loud, pressure-assisted toilets, it’s a bit noisy. We all were woken early with the sound every toilet in our vicinity — adjacent, above-below, across — every time it flushed. And since it was St Patty’s Parade weekend, the revelers were heard all night too(and days, for that matter). If you’re planning to use the kitchen, you might want to bring a smaller sauce pan. While they stocked with good stuff, the pots were big. Seating in the living room was stiff, but deal-able. Wi-Fi needs to improve — we were only on for a few minutes all weekend, so be prepared to use a lot of cellular data. Overall, I’d stay again, especially because the location is perfect.
